Risk factors for HIV seropositivity among people consulting for HIV antibody testing: a pilot surveillance study in Quebec.

Abstract

The surveillance of AIDS (acquired immune deficiency syndrome) through case reporting only reflects the epidemiologic features of HIV (human immunodeficiency virus) transmission a few years earlier and not the prevalence of HIV seropositivity. HIV infection is not a notifiable condition in Quebec. We were asked by the ministère de la Santé et des Services sociaux du Québec to perform a pilot project for the surveillance of HIV seropositivity using a network of sentinel physicians. From May 15, 1988, to Sept. 30, 1989, physicians from four collaborating centres collected data on the serologic status, demographic characteristics and risk factors for 4209 patients who underwent HIV antibody testing. Of the 3899 subjects included in the study 7.9% were HIV positive. Through logistic regression analysis the following variables were found to be significantly associated with HIV seropositivity: presence of HIV-related symptoms (prevalence odds ratio [POR] 36.5), origin from an endemic area (POR 9.1), homosexuality or bisexuality (POR 8.4), intravenous drug use (POR 4.2), male sex (POR 2.8), previous HIV antibody testing (POR 2.5) and previous sexually transmitted disease (POR 1.8). Over the study period we found a large increase in HIV seroprevalence among intravenous drug users (4.2% in 1988 to 19.0% in 1989) (p = 0.02). This increase might reflect a recent change in the epidemiologic pattern of HIV transmission in Quebec. Surveillance of HIV seropositivity through a network of sentinel physicians may be a reasonable alternative to mandatory reporting.
